Tonight Is the Snow, Storm, and Hunger Moon – Here Are Some Amazing Celestial Events Coming Up Next – Brinkwire
The next full Moon will be early Saturday morning, February 27, 2021, appearing opposite the Sun in Earth-based longitude at 3:17 AM EST.
This will be on Friday night from Alaskas timezone westward to the International Date Line.
The Moon will appear full for about three days around this time, from Thursday night through Sunday morning.
